Zero Hour uses a notoriously sensitive sync-check system. If you try to use a trainer on GameRanger, CNCNet, or even LAN, you will cause a "CRC Mismatch" or "Desync" error. The match will crash, and the community will ban your IP instantly. The Zero Hour community is small but vicious. Keep cheats strictly for solo skirmishes against the AI.

This is the most common Zero Hour crash. If it happens while using a trainer, it means the trainer tried to write data to a memory address that shifted or closed. To fix this, always activate the trainer after the loading screen finishes and you are actively inside the match. Cheats Applying to the Enemy AI
